Description

The Service will enable clients to maintain day to day control of their money and support packages; have the opportunity to make informed choices about how their eligible care needs are met, and how best to match available resources to meet their needs. The Service must be flexible to meet the changing needs of clients. The payroll element of the Service is currently managed in two (2) ways: • Basic service - Clients submit signed time sheets and the payroll provider calculates pay information; • Holding service - in addition to undertaking the payroll calculations, the Provider holds monies on behalf of more vulnerable and less able clients and make the payments on behalf of the client. The current provider has advised that they are insolvent. The Council needed to put in a new supplier to support individuals to continue with their Direct Payments and employment of their Personal Assistants. In accordance with Schedule 5 of the Procurement Act 2023, the Council is awarding a contract via a Direct Award on the grounds of extreme emergency as set out in the Act.
